Our group focuses on various topics including:
-
Developing and designing Interactive & Intelligent Music Technologies (I2MT).
-
Understanding human computer & AI interactions in musicking.
-
Understanding musicking practices with I2MT.
-
Enhancing human creativity with AI.
- Developing new forms of music expression in VR
